Wee Write 2022

Family Day 30 April,2022, 10 a.m. until 4p.m.
Tickets for the fabulous Wee Write Family Day are on sale now!
At The Mitchell Library, North Street, Glasgow G3 7DN
A fun packed day of songs and rhymes, storytelling, creative play and loads more! Celebrate Harry Potter Magic, cower at the Two Terrible Vikings and Grunt the Berserker and find out if Slugboy Saves the World! All this, plus loads of free fun from Bookbug, the Play Talk Read bus and there’s even the chance to meet The Gruffalo! It is a must for all the little bookworms in your life.
